Investco Scout is an investment research company. Create the ER diagram for the Investco Scout Funds Database, based on the following requirements. • The Investco Scout Funds Database will keep track of investment companies, the mutual funds they manage, and securities contained in the mutual funds. . For each investment company, Investco Scout will keep track of a unique investment company identifier and a unique investment company name as well as the names of multiple locations of the investment company. . . For each security, Investco Scout will keep track of a unique security identifier as well as the security name and type. . • Investment companies can manage multiple mutual funds. Investco Scout does not keep track of investment companies that do not manage any mutual funds. A mutual fund is managed by one investment company. . For each mutual fund, Investco Scout will keep track of a unique mutual fund identifier as well as the mutual fund name and inception date. . A mutual fund contains one or many securities. Security can be included in many mutual funds. Investco Scout keeps track of securities that are not included in any mutual funds. For each instance of security included in a mutual fund, Investco Scout keeps track of the amount included. For each investment company, Investco Scout keeps track of how many mutual funds they manage. Investco Scout is an investment research company.
